What drinks speed metabolism?
Drink green tea or oolong tea
Green tea and oolong tea have been shown to increase metabolism and fat burning ( 27 , 28). These teas help convert some of the fat stored in your body into free fatty acids, which may increase fat burning when combined with exercise ( 29 ).
What actually boosts metabolism?
Fat-burning ingredients like protein, spicy peppers and green tea have been proven to bump up metabolism. Eat some form of these foods, especially protein, at every meal. Protein is especially important: It takes more calories to digest than other foods and also helps the body build fat-burning lean muscle tissue.

Who should not drink green juice?
Speaking of kidneys, people with kidney disease or kidney stones should be wary of juicing, says Dr. Mary Jo Kasten, assistant professor of medicine at the Mayo Clinic. Kasten wrote an article about a patient with kidney disease who experienced kidney failure after a six-week juice fast.

How often should you drink green juice?
I recommend 1-2 juices per day in order to receive the equivalent of 2-4 servings of fruits and vegetables.” Another reason juices should serve as supplements rather than meal replacements: Unlike smoothies, which retain their ingredients’ fiber, juices are stripped of all their dietary fiber.
